Bonnie here is what I found on the Crinkle: "Unlike the shiny japan finish on the Standard Featherweight 221, the bed of the Featherweight 221 crinkle machine has a dull textured finish and three parallel grooves cut into the perimeter. Its faceplate is either the standard plated striated faceplate that was introduced on Featherweights during the AH serial number series in 1947 or a plain black faceplate with three vertical grooves down the center."
